The wording on WDW's website indicates "Please note that all park visits must be within 30 to 2 days of the live chat." Some people are finding they are allowed to book all the Advanced Selections at 30 days from the first park day; others have been told they'll need to reconnect to make the rest of their Advanced Selections for dates more than 30 days away. There doesn't seem to be any particular pattern or "qualifier" for doing all early, just pixie dust from the CM.
